just throught i would throw this out there, some friends and i have been thinking about a trip out to the flats, found out some other friends went out and rented a motor home and got busted by the rv place for taking the rental out on the salt. they power washed the unit afterwards but the rv place checked it over good and found salt , and it cost them over a grand in penalties. ouch!
Rooms at Speed Week are always scarce. The hotels/casinos don't start taking booking for Speed Week until early Jan. Wendover is a tiny place with a limited number of rooms. Speed Week 2010 is Aug. 14-20 and World Finals is Oct. 6-9. Rooms are more readily available for World Finals as it is a smaller meet. I always stay at Bend in the Road.
